Mr. Fletcher was born on August 19th, 1942 in Yadkin County to the late Paul Fletcher and Adelene Hutchens Fletcher.
Mr. Fletcher retired from Thomasville Furniture after 37 years of service.
Those left to cherish his memory are his loving wife of 32 years, Johnnie Sue Key Fletcher of the home; two sons Wayne Fletcher of East Bend and Michael (Mandy) Hall of Mount Airy; three daughters Diane "Tootie" Bray of Elkin, Debbie Frady of Hamptonville, and Tina (Gary) Kendrick of Bassett, VA; six brothers John (Vexie) of Yadkinville, Waymie of King, Gary of Tobaccoville, Jim (Bobbie) of Tobaccoville, twins Donnie and Ronnie of East Bend; one sister Nancy Fletcher of East Bend; eleven grandchildren and five great grandchildren.
A graveside service for Mr. Fletcher will be held at 11am on Saturday July 5th, 2014 at East Bend Evangelical Methodist Church Cemetery with the Pastor Jimmy Davis officiating.
